An education literacy coach resume is one of the most influential factors in securing a new reading or literacy coach position.
For
an education literacy coach application, schools will be looking for keywords specific to the job, such as reading assessment, standardized testing, common core, step up to writing, guided reading and writing, reader's / writer's workshop, etc..
